site stats

React redux vs hooks

WebMar 2, 2024 · This article compares state management in React Hooks vs Redux. What is React Hooks? Introduced on ReactJS version 16.8, Hooks are functions that allow you to … WebReact Hook Form - Performant, flexible and extensible forms with easy-to-use validation.. Redux Form - Manage your form state in Redux.

React Hooks vs Redux for State Management in 2024

WebReact hooks API allows us to use state and lifecycle functionalities in functional components. This tutorial assumes that you already have some basic knowledge about redux, if don’t know about it you can check out my … WebApr 13, 2024 · Redux makes the state predictable. In Redux, the state is always predictable. If the same state and action move to a reducer, it will obtain the same result because reducers are pure functions. The state is also immutable and is never changed. It makes it possible to implement arduous tasks like infinite undo and redo. games that are trending https://vazodentallab.com

Hooks React Redux - js

WebJan 3, 2024 · Using the Hooks API, we can apply the same basic functional programming concepts that Redux uses to transform state without introducing additional dependencies or creating double the components. Let’s take a look at how we can combine contexts and the useReducer hook to create a store that all of the components in a React app can talk to. WebJan 2, 2024 · You can now clearly see the difference between Redux and React Context through their implementations on our project. However, Redux is far from dead or be killed by React Context. Redux is such a boilerplate and requires a bunch of libraries. But it remains a great solution towards props drilling. WebJun 1, 2024 · Redux on the other hand completely separate the state and the UI components. That becomes handy because you can pick whatever data you want anywhere you want. This is a genius move because you... black gymnastics girl name

A State management comparison with React hooks, mobx and …

Category:React Hook Form vs Redux Form What are the differences?

Tags:React redux vs hooks

React redux vs hooks

How to convert from React-Redux classes to React Hooks

WebOct 11, 2024 · Hooks are a new addition in React 16.8. They let you use state and other React features without writing a class. This… reactjs.org Reuse I don’t know if it’s because I was especially motivated when I started to implement the project with hooks, but the general sensation is that they greatly favor code reuse. WebAug 24, 2024 · Note that these Hooks benefits don’t overlap the benefits of Redux. Though React Hooks and Redux work differently, both can be useful in the API process. You can …

React redux vs hooks

Did you know?

WebMay 13, 2024 · React's useReducer Hook vs Redux. Since React Hooks have been released, function components can use state and side-effects. There are two hooks that are used … WebJan 18, 2024 · The React-Redux library is the official UI binding layer that lets React components interact with a Redux store by reading values from Redux state and dispatching actions. So, when most people refer to "Redux", they actually mean "using a Redux store and the React-Redux library together".

WebSep 19, 2024 · What is the difference between using hooks and connect to my React-Redux project There are two major differences: Scope connect can be used with both React … WebFeb 23, 2024 · React Hooks vs. Redux. Redux has been the go-to solution for developers when it comes to state management. To some extent, it works well for state management in React apps. However, because of its ...

WebJul 25, 2024 · In other words, Redux gives you code organization and debugging superpowers. It makes it easier to build more maintainable code, and much easier to track … WebMay 15, 2024 · In React Redux we initialize the state in the constructor and have a dedicated setState () function. Both “state” and “setState ()” are reserved names. This is not so in React hooks. In React Hooks we create our own “state” keyword and setState () function ourselves with the useState () Hook.

WebRedux as I use it is best for shared data. Not cached, but shared. If you have a temperature sensor that is rendered in 4 different components, Redux will be better than 4 components sending a GraphQL request. Redux being obsolete is my personal opinion. As for shared state, I use Apollo client .

WebAug 4, 2024 · There’s a conceptual difference between React’s useReducer vs. reducers in Redux. In React we write as many reducers as we like: they’re just Hooks to make it easier to update state. In... games that are supported for nvidiaWebWe recommend using the React-Redux hooks API as the default approach in your React components. The existing connect API still works and will continue to be supported, but … games that are similar to pokemonWebMay 25, 2024 · Here is the counter app from earlier but refactored using these React-Redux Hooks: Epic, efficient and sweet. Again you probably would not use Redux for a simple app like this, but you can see how ... black gymnastic shortsWebJan 31, 2024 · Also, this solution is easy to test. From a high level perspective, this solution works the same as thunk. The flowchart from the thunk example is still applicable. To make it work we need to do 6 things. 1. Install saga. npm install redux-saga. 2. Add saga middleware and add all sagas (configureStore.js) games that are two playersWebJun 16, 2024 · As of version 7.1, Redux supports React Hooks, meaning you can use Redux with Hooks in your functional components instead of using Redux connect(). With that said, it’s useful to understand the core concept of separating business logic from presentational components because it can simplify solving a lot of complex problems. games that avoid capitalistic designWebApr 11, 2024 · Pros/cons of using redux-saga with ES6 generators vs redux-thunk with ES2024 async/await 0 Can't access data from redux toolkit with typescript games that are virusesWebApr 16, 2024 · React Redux 8.x requires React 16.8.3 or later / React Native 0.59 or later, in order to make use of React Hooks. Using Create React App The recommended way to start new apps with React and Redux is by using the official Redux+JS template or Redux+TS template for Create React App , which takes advantage of Redux Toolkit and React … black gym red and white 13s